#bd1efe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d1efe is composed of 74.1% red, 11.8%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.6% cyan, 88.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 282.6 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 55.7%. #bd1efe color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3cff with #7b00fd.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#bd1efe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d1efe has RGB values of R:189, G:30,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 12394238.

Shades and Tints of #bd1efe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070009 is the darkest color, while #fcf5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d1efe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918696 is the less saturated color, while #bd1efe is the most saturated one.
